    Benchmark of Speed and Aesthetics: UT5 Series Sports Car-Inspired Racing Electric Scooters

    As the most eye-catching series at the booth, the NAVEE UT5 series is centered on sports car-level aesthetic design, perfectly integrating speed and appearance. Unlike traditional racing electric scooters that solely pursue performance, the UT5 series focuses more on the all-dimensional upgrade of vision and senses. The NAVEE UT5 Ultra X electric scooter is equipped with a Boost extreme acceleration system, making speed bursts more impactful—it can accelerate from 0 to 12 mph in 1.78 seconds with a top speed of 43 mph. Equipped with 360° immersive lighting effects, it can become an absolute focus on the street whether shuttling during the day or galloping at night. With the triple advantages of "racing + aesthetics + immersive experience", the UT5 series sets a new benchmark for high-performance aesthetics in the electric scooter field.

    Master of All Terrains: NT5 Series All-Terrain Awakening Off-Road Electric Scooters

    Tailored for outdoor off-road enthusiasts, NAVEE launched the NT5 series all-terrain off-road electric scooters, with the core positioning of "Unleash Wildness, Control the Unknown". Relying on the all-terrain control system, combined with front dual telescopic and rear damping arm suspension design, as well as dual disc brake + EABS braking system design, this series ensures precise control of every turn and braking, easily conquering complex road conditions such as gravel and steep slopes. The installation of a low-mounted integrated lighting system further ensures the safety of off-road driving at night, giving users more confidence when exploring unknown road conditions.

    Empowering Diverse Scenarios: Full-Category Products Cover All Dimensions of Life

    In addition to the electric scooter series that NAVEE has been deeply cultivating, the new product matrix released at CES this year also covers multiple core usage scenarios:

    • Urban Commuting Scenario: GT5 Max Comfort Commuting Electric Scooter, based on long battery life and strong power, combined with front fork and rear damping cylinder and wide pedal design, brings a full-level comfortable experience for daily commuters.
    • Outdoor Exploration Scenario: The Storm X series off-road electric dirt bike, with its super strong power, extreme torque, optimized body rigidity, and overall vehicle tuning, becomes a hardcore choice for outdoor off-roading; the electric wagon cart 4X with 3000W four-wheel drive power and a top load capacity of 771 lbs, turns into a multi-functional transportation tool for outdoor camping.
    Navee electric wagon cart 4X
    • Water Entertainment Scenario: The WaveFly 5X water seaplane breaks the boundary of land mobility, allowing users to enjoy the fun of gliding on the water, making every shuttle a unique adventure.
    • Sports and Leisure Scenario: The Eagle F1X and other golf push cart series are equipped with industry-leading AI visual self-following technology and intelligent obstacle avoidance functions, with built-in maps of more than 40,000 golf courses around the world, bringing a more convenient and intelligent sports experience for golf enthusiasts.
